Skip to content

Implement more programming languages #4

@noah1510

Description

@noah1510

Since the most complex part of this library is the generation of the python data, adding more programing languages is relatively easy.
This is the meta issue to keep track of what has already been implemented and what is planned.
Each export target should get its own issue which is linked to this.

  • C++
    • meson
    • arduino
  • python
  • Java
  • Rust
  • C#
  • Go

If you feel like anything is missing leave a comment with your suggested language.

The following languages are unlikely to get a port:

  • C -> due to the simple nature of C, a port of this library would not be practical
  • javascript -> There is basically no type safety, so most advantages of using this over simple number would be gone.

Metadata

Metadata

Assignees

No one assigned

    Labels

    New TargetSuggestions or being worked onenhancementNew feature or request

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ions